Transaction 60e378b96dfa5d04f5148d65396fcef046e8ebf5c4d7ecec47989db43ea18995

3 Input
2 Outputs
  • 60e378b96dfa5d04f5148d65396fcef046e8ebf5c4d7ecec47989db43ea18995:0
  • value  41022275
    address  1JiBMKx5gwGJWe9ZyyGq6Qx32sKkpLbEak
  • 60e378b96dfa5d04f5148d65396fcef046e8ebf5c4d7ecec47989db43ea18995:1
  • value  3326009
    address  3HpCwiSgjQG2zKAHb3kTCQkw3gSrzsnSru